Linguine Substitute for Spaghetti: Exact Ratio

Looking for a spaghetti substitute? Linguine works as a direct replacement. Use 1:1 in any recipe that calls for spaghetti. This swap works best for seafood sauces, pesto, cream sauces.

Best Substitute

Linguine

1:1

Slightly wider and flatter than spaghetti but nearly interchangeable. Holds thicker sauces slightly better.

Tips When Replacing Spaghetti in Recipes

Cook spaghetti in a large pot with plenty of salted water (1 tablespoon salt per quart). Reserve a cup of starchy pasta water before draining to help bind sauces. Traditional Italian spaghetti is slightly thicker than most American brands.

What Is Spaghetti and Why Substitute It?

A long, thin, cylindrical pasta that is one of the most popular pasta shapes worldwide. Spaghetti is traditionally made from durum wheat semolina and is the classic pairing for tomato-based sauces, carbonara, aglio e olio, and bolognese.
